move freshrss to kubernetes
This commit is contained in:
parent
fcb6e2ca37
commit
709e4b25d7
5 changed files with 29 additions and 15 deletions
|
@ -3,7 +3,6 @@
|
|||
hosts: manager
|
||||
roles:
|
||||
- {role: traefik, tags: traefik}
|
||||
- {role: freshrss, tags: freshrss}
|
||||
- {role: forgejo, tags: forgejo}
|
||||
- {role: radicale, tags: radicale}
|
||||
- {role: hedgedoc, tags: hedgedoc}
|
||||
|
|
|
@ -1,3 +1,5 @@
|
|||
- debug:
|
||||
msg: "{{ admin_password }}"
|
||||
- name: Deploy Docker stack
|
||||
docker_stack:
|
||||
name: freshrss
|
||||
|
|
|
@ -61,11 +61,11 @@ services:
|
|||
- traefik.http.routers.cyberchef.tls=true
|
||||
- traefik.http.routers.cyberchef.tls.certresolver=letsencrypt
|
||||
|
||||
- traefik.http.routers.freshrss-k3s.entrypoints=websecure
|
||||
- traefik.http.routers.freshrss-k3s.service=k3s@file
|
||||
- traefik.http.routers.freshrss-k3s.rule=Host(`freshrss.k3s.kun.is`)
|
||||
- traefik.http.routers.freshrss-k3s.tls=true
|
||||
- traefik.http.routers.freshrss-k3s.tls.certresolver=letsencrypt
|
||||
- traefik.http.routers.freshrss.entrypoints=websecure
|
||||
- traefik.http.routers.freshrss.service=k3s@file
|
||||
- traefik.http.routers.freshrss.rule=Host(`rss.kun.is`)
|
||||
- traefik.http.routers.freshrss.tls=true
|
||||
- traefik.http.routers.freshrss.tls.certresolver=letsencrypt
|
||||
volumes:
|
||||
- type: bind
|
||||
source: /var/run/docker.sock
|
||||
|
|
Reference in a new issue